Throughout the 2023 Fall semester, I took the ITSS 4351: Foundation of Business Intelligence, which helped improve my technical skills and brought impactful friends and connections within this industry. This class challenged me to improve my technical skills while also honing what the business analytics industry entails. With the help of my professor, I? Today I am thrilled to share the incredible journey and learning experiences from my Foundation of Business Intelligence class!?

Mastering Tableau Analytics: First, I could dive deep into the world of data visualization with Tableau! I learned to transform raw data into actionable insights, turning complex information into visually appealing charts such as sunburst charts, and understandable dashboards. I also learned Tableau's different analytic features, such as the trend line, which helped increase my knowledge in hypothesis testing.? This skill has been a game-changer in translating data into strategic decisions.

Visual Studio Mastery: In the second half of the semester, I explored the powerful functionalities of Visual Studio for Business Intelligence projects. This tool has become my go-to for enhancing data-driven decision-making processes, from designing data models such as decision trees and Neural Networks to creating impactful reports.

?SQL Management Studio Expertise: Unraveled the complexities of SQL Management Studio, gaining proficiency in managing and manipulating databases. This hands-on experience has empowered me to extract valuable information efficiently and enhance data-driven strategies.

Group Collaboration: A key highlight of the course was the emphasis on teamwork and collaboration. Working on group projects honed my technical skills and improved my ability to communicate complex findings effectively, fostering a collaborative mindset crucial in the professional world. I got different perspectives on how to approach the project technically.?

Career Impact as a Business Analyst: Fast forward to today, and these skills have proven invaluable in my role as a Business Analyst! Leveraging Tableau for data visualization has allowed me to present insights compellingly, aiding my coworkers and managers in making informed decisions. Visual Studio and SQL Management Studio have become indispensable tools in my daily tasks, streamlining data processes and ensuring accuracy in reporting.
